你的username和password的逗号和双引号貌似打成中文的了吧?

解决方案 »

  1.   

    我在发帖的时候手打的,打错了,程序里是没问题的
    你这样试试:
    sqlConn.executeUpdagte("insert into user_test(`name`,`password`) values('" + username + "','" + password + "')");
      

  2.   

    我在发帖的时候手打的,打错了,程序里是没问题的
    你这样试试:
    sqlConn.executeUpdagte("insert into user_test(`name`,`password`) values('" + username + "','" + password + "')");
    试了还是不行,you have an error in your SQL syntax; check the manual that correspond to your MySQL server version for the right syntax to use near ' 'user_test'('name','password') value('test','123')' at line 1
      

  3.   

    我在发帖的时候手打的,打错了,程序里是没问题的
    你这样试试:
    sqlConn.executeUpdagte("insert into user_test(`name`,`password`) values('" + username + "','" + password + "')");
    试了还是不行,you have an error in your SQL syntax; check the manual that correspond to your MySQL server version for the right syntax to use near ' 'user_test'('name','password') value('test','123')' at line 1
    怎么错误信息和我的这句不一致?我的user_test没加引号,其次`name`,`password`的那个两个不是引号,还有我的是values而你给的错误信息是value。你是在试我的这句么
      

  4.   

    你的mysql 版本 不支持 这样的sql语法, 就是那个字符引号的问题, 后面vlaues 的改成前面 那个, 如果是多条sql要加上; 
      

  5.   

    我在发帖的时候手打的,打错了,程序里是没问题的
    你这样试试:
    sqlConn.executeUpdagte("insert into user_test(`name`,`password`) values('" + username + "','" + password + "')");
    试了还是不行,you have an error in your SQL syntax; check the manual that correspond to your MySQL server version for the right syntax to use near ' 'user_test'('name','password') value('test','123')' at line 1
    怎么错误信息和我的这句不一致?我的user_test没加引号,其次`name`,`password`的那个两个不是引号,还有我的是values而你给的错误信息是value。你是在试我的这句么
    终于解决了,我还是标点写错了,我把你那句复制进去就成功了,username那个是什么符号?好像不是单引号。我的是苹果电脑,怎么才能打出来?谢谢前辈了
      

  6.   

    呃。。我不用苹果电脑的。。在windows电脑的键盘上是符号‘~’所在的那个键那里有个字符'`',一般是数字1的左边那个键